Ford Mondeo is more dynamic to drive. Ford Mondeo and Opel Insignia have the same engine power, but Ford Mondeo torque is 120 NM more than Opel Insignia. Ford Mondeo reaches 100 km/h speed 0.7 seconds faster. | |||

The Ford Mondeo is a better choice in terms of fuel economy based on user-reported consumption, although the specification shows otherwise. By specification Ford Mondeo consumes 0.4 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Opel Insignia, which means that if you drive 15,000 km in a year, the Ford Mondeo could require 60 litres more fuel. But when we compare the real fuel consumption reported by users, Ford Mondeo consumes 0.8 litres less fuel per 100 km than the Opel Insignia. | |||

Engine resource depends largely on regular maintenance and the quality of the oils and fuels used, but under equal conditions the average life of a Ford Mondeo engine could be longer. | |||

In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ts. Opel Insignia might be a better choice in this respect. | |||
Ford Mondeo 2010 2.0 engine: In early production engines, the camshaft timing chain often stretched, requiring timely replacement to avoid potential issues. The fuel system, equipped with piezo injectors, is highly sensitive to fuel ... More about Ford Mondeo 2010 2.0 engine | |||

Opel Insignia has more luggage space. Ford Mondeo has 44 litres less trunk space than the Opel Insignia. The maximum boot capacity (with all rear seats folded down) is larger in Opel Insignia (by 80 litres). | |||

The turning circle of the Ford Mondeo is 0.5 metres more than that of the Opel Insignia, which means Ford Mondeo can be harder to manoeuvre in tight streets and parking spaces. | |||

Opel Insignia has fewer problems. According to annual technical inspection data Ford Mondeo has serious deffects in 60 percent more cases than Opel Insignia, so Opel Insignia quality is probably significantly better | |||
